Default avatar settings ignored in comments shown in WordPress Admin and dashboard widget

Description

Having tested and confirmed on three separate WordPress installations, when perusing the Activity widget on the WordPress dashboard or reading comments from WordPress Admin, all comments that use default avatars show ONLY "Mystery Man" avatars, regardless of what default avatar is checked in settings.

Selecting either Blank, Gravatar Logo, Identicon, Wavatar, MonsterID or Retro as default avatars all appears to have no effect in Admin, but they appear correctly on the WordPress site itself.

Duplicate of #25764.

Not showing auto-generated Gravatars for comment authors in the admin was an intended change in #7054 to make comment moderation easier.
